Layered Beetroot Chia Pudding
Recipe details
  • 2  People
  • Prep time: 10 Minutes Cook time: 0 Minutes Total time: 10 min

Ingredients
For The Plain Chia Pudding
  • 2 tbsp Chia Seeds
  • 2 tsp Honey
  • 1/4 cup Milk
For The Beetroot Chia Pudding
  • 2 tbsp Chia Seeds
  • 2 tsp Honey
  • 1/4 cup Milk
  • 2 Tsp Beetroot Powder
Instructions
For The Chia Pudding
To prepare plain Chia pudding in a bowl/jar add 2 tbsp Chia seeds ,honey and milk.
Mix everything well and keep it aside.
Now in another bowl/jar add 2 tbsp Chia seeds,honey,milk and beetroot powder and mix everything well.
Then keep the bowls in the refrigerator for minimum 4 hours to overnight. I like to let the chia pudding set in the fridge for overnight. it gives enough time for Chia seeds to soak in the water.
Then at the time of serving prepare layer of plain and beetroot Chia pudding and serve them with your favorite fresh berries.
